Factors to Consider Before Choosing a Paint Color
Before diving into a new paint color, take a moment to consider these key factors that can influence your decision and ensure a harmonious end result.
Climate and Weather Conditions
Different climates can affect how paint colors appear over time. In sunny regions, colors may fade faster, while darker hues can absorb heat. Take your climate into account to choose a color that will stand the test of time.
Existing Exterior Elements to Coordinate With
Consider your home’s architectural style, roof color, landscaping, and any existing elements that will interact with your new paint color. Harmonizing these elements can create a cohesive look that enhances your home’s overall aesthetic.
Neighborhood Considerations
While you want your home to stand out, it’s essential to consider your neighborhood’s overall aesthetic. Striking a balance between individuality and blending in with the surroundings can help maintain property values and neighborhood harmony.

How Natural Light Affects Paint Color Selection
Natural light can significantly impact how paint colors appear, so it’s crucial to consider your home’s orientation and the changing light throughout the day.
North-Facing vs. South-Facing Homes
North-facing homes receive cooler light, which can make colors appear more subdued. South-facing homes, on the other hand, get warmer light that can enhance bolder hues. Understanding your home’s orientation can help you choose a color that looks its best.
Shade and Sunlight Variations Throughout the Day
Take note of how sunlight moves around your home throughout the day. A color that looks perfect in the morning might appear different in the evening.
